Frequently Asked Questions About Slow English

What is Slow English about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Focusing on topics related to Australian culture, language, and lifestyle, the discussions are tailored for intermediate English learners. Each episode offers insights into everyday aspects of life in Australia, including popular foods, sports, geographical features, and language nuances. The host shares personal experiences, anecdotes, and educational content, making each episode a blend of entertainment and learning. Additionally, the podcast uniquely addresses specific challenges faced by non-native speakers while offering practical advice on how to improve English skills through cultural immersion and language practice.
